What is Polish bimber?
Bimber – Księżycówka “Moonshine” Polish homemade vodka. Those are generic terms for distilled alcoholic beverages made throughout the all Poland from indigenous ingredients reflecting the customs, tastes, and raw materials for fermentation available in each region.
Should limoncello be refrigerated?
Limoncello does not require refrigeration for long-term storage. However, as is the tradition along the Amalfi Coast, we highly recommend chilling Fiore Limoncello either in the refrigerator or preferably in the freezer for several hours prior to serving.
Why do you drink limoncello after dinner?
Limoncello is considered a digestif (after-dinner drink), thought to aid digestion. It is much sweeter and generally lower in alcohol content than hard alcohols like vodka or whiskey.

What is Polish nalewka?
In Poland, an aged liqueur or cordial is known as nalewka (nah-LEF-kah) (nalewki when plural), and literally translates to “tincture.” They are primarily made with fruit, sugar, honey, molasses, herbs, and spices macerated in vodka or rectified spirits known as spirytus rektyfikowany.

What is nalewka Tarninow?
A popular nalewka named after a town is Nalewka Tarninówk a, originating from the town of Tarnów near Kraków in Małopolska (Lesser Poland). It’s made with sloe berries and is ruby red in color. Many recipes are closely guarded secrets, passed down from generation to generation.
